Not sure why this is happening. When I specify the ROM_IMAGE_SIZE to be
larger than 64k. The file linuxbios.strip is larger than linuxbios,
which is the file before the objcopy. This doesn't happen to the
rom_image_size that is 64k.
Here is the file size info.
